What is the HEX code for Pine Grove?
The HEX code for Pine Grove is #223631. This is a digital standard used for displaying color on screens in web design, social media, and mobile apps.
What is the RGB value for Pine Grove?
The RGB value for Pine Grove is rgb(34, 54, 49). Like HEX, the RGB color model is used for digital screens, including monitors, cameras, and scanners.
